Agreed with pretty much everyone here: it's a simple business reality that the days of film as a mainstream presentation medium are numbered. In the same way that the last few years of vinyl LPs were characterised by poor quality and impure PVC, thin pressings and 40 minutes on a side, so many of today's 35mm prints are poorly timed, have a wobbly picture and are generally depressing to watch. I suspect the reason is simply that labs' margins are being squeezed as the focus of R & D is moving elsewhere.
On the archival front, it seems to me that there are two distinct issues. 1 - How to ensure the long-term preservation of material originated on film on film; and 2 - whether and how the film viewing experience can be preserved in at least some rep houses, museums, cinematheques and so on.
I've never been able to find out the exact figure, but would guess that during the peak of the 35mm film era (in both movie and still imaging), most of the stock manufactured was release print stock. The introduction of digital imaging for stills didn't affect this very much, because while tens of millions of feet were being made each year for theatre prints, the loss of a small fraction when still photography went digital didn't affect the economies of scale so much. However, now that, as Brad points out, the film era is nearly over and we're at the point where the big studios are on the verge of discontinuing 35mm printing, it won't be long before film is not going to be made in any significant quantities any more; and that will be the game changer for preservation.
At the moment, any ethical issues apart, film is still the most cost-effective way to preserve high-quality moving images. If store it cold and dry enough it'll last for centuries - even nitrate. The hardware needed to make digital copies from your film originals is never going to be that complex or expensive to make, and so no format migration for preservation is necessary - only for access.
Given the storage and migration issues involved in storing any digital data long-term, no-one in their right mind is going to migrate film originals for preservation to digital and then put the film in the dumpster. It won't be cost-effective to do so until you can buy a petabyte of storage over twenty years for a few bucks. I'm not saying that moment will never come: I vividly remember a chief projectionist I worked for in the early '90s tell me emphatically that computers will never be powerful enough to project film-quality moving images. His 'never' turned out to be a decade and a half.
If and when that moment does come, the issue will shift from an economic issue to an ethical one. On that score, I'm not too downhearted. In the last 10-20 years, commercial studio archives and taxpayer-funded ones have developed close and effective working links: the studios realise that their back catalogues represent a major asset, and they also realise that non-profit archives, curators, boutique DVD publishers such as Kino and Milestone, universities etc. help to create and sustain the market for that asset. Unethical so-called 'restoration' practices are likely to become a major issue (3D-izing 1940s classics and that sort of thing), but as long as the originals are preserved, they won't cause major damage.
Preserving the film viewing experience could well prove more tricky. Again, I turn to the analogy with vinyl LPs. There are still a small number of cottage industry manufacturers producing turntables and records for a die-hard market of enthusiasts. The economies of scale for this just about work, because mechanically and electrically, the technology is a relatively simple one. I'm hoping that the same will apply to 35mm projection: that the machine tooling needed to refurbish an intermittent (for example), and the chemistry needed to make and process at least black-and-white stock is straightforward enough that even if the market dwindles to a couple of hundred theatres worldwide, it'll still just about be possible to support them. We're not going to find this out in the next few years, because the stocks of machines and spares in circulation will still be in use.
But we're certainly in the final stages of saying goodbye to film in mainstream theatres; and like everyone else, the archive and film heritage worlds are just going to have to deal with it.

quote: Manny Knowles The "digital revolution" can't be blamed if original elements are in poor shape. If anything, digital technology will probably play some role in the restoration/preservation effort.
It already is, to the extent that like 35mm projection in theatres, analogue preservation methods (e.g. wet-gate printing to reduce scratches, physically assembling reels to be preservation duped from multiple sources etc.) are already the exception that proves the rule. There are some preservationists who stick to these methods on ethical grounds, e.g. Ross Lipman at UCLA or Mark Toscano at AMPAS, but the normal workflow now is to scan all the elements you can find, either as you find them or with the bare minimum of physical treatment needed to get them through a scanner > carry out reconstruction and/or image correction digitally > laser out a preservation negative to go in the vault. Modern toothless, sprocket-free scanners such as the ones made by MWA-Nova or Kinetta don't mind torn perforations, shrunken and brittle stock, very dry cement joins and all those problems that previously could have added up to hundreds of hours of bench repair before you even get near a printer. In most cases it's now cheaper to scan whatever you've got, warts and all, and do a software cleanup than it is to repair and/or clean elements before scanning.

quote: Martin McCaffrey That says, as I've mentioned elsewhere, the studios have discovered the best way and cheapest way to preserve their films is with B&W separations on film. How many films they decide need to be preserved is a whole other question.
From what I've been hearing, the seps route has turned out to be not such a good idea. The problem is that the three elements don't shrink at the same rate, with the result that achieving accurate registration gets more and more difficult the older your seps are. At AMIA either last year or the year before (can't quite remember), there was a presentation from someone who'd just prepared new DCPs and HD masters of Chinatown. He said that he started with seps made during the original post-production, but that the differential shrinkage was so bad that it was impossible to combine them without fringing, either by three-pass printing to a new interpositive or digitally. In the end, scanning a dye-faded fine grain and doing digital colour correction yielded much better results, because at least the three emulsions were in the right place relative to each other.
Making YCMs was considered the way to go during the '80s and '90s, when dye fading was known about but acetate stock shrinking was not very well understood (base shrinkage was thought to only affect nitrate). Martin Scorsese was a particular fan of the process, and it is rumoured that he insisted in a clause in his contracts with studios that they would make and preserve a set of YCMs of every film he directed. There were a lot of re-releases of material preserved on YCMs during that time that actually look almost unwatchable now, so bad is the colour fringing. We're now in a situation whereby dye fading can be corrected digitally very easily - by using different coloured light in the scanner, you can read the three emulsion records separately and then have the computer restore the timing to account for the differential fades of the three colour records - but the misalignment resulting from the differential shrinkage of YCMs has proven a much tougher nut to crack.
And of course once you've done all this, you've then got the extra problem of preserving the dataset...
